Indian Phenome Repository (IPR) is a national initiative established under the Indian Biological Data Centre (IBDC) to promote the submission, sustainable archival, and access of high-quality phenomic data across diverse biological domains.
Aligned with international FAIR (Findable, Accessible, Interoperable, and Reusable) and CARE (Collective Benefit, Authority to Control, Responsibility, and Ethics) data principles, IPRI ensures that its datasets are not only scientifically robust and reusable but also developed and shared with a strong commitment to ethical stewardship, equity, and Indigenous data sovereignty.
IPRI serves as a trusted platform for both Indian and global research communities working in the fields of health, agriculture, environment, and biotechnology.
Our mission is to provide a centralized, standardized platform for phenomic data that enables researchers to share, discover, and reuse high-quality phenotypic information.
